dubbo3-透过源码认识你[笔记]

dubbo 3版本后两大变化:对云原生基础设施与部署架构的支持,zookeeper存储节点结构变化:(事实上后者从2.75版本就开始了)

Zookeeper.png

[zk: localhost:2181(CONNECTED) 3] ls /
[dubbo, services, zookeeper]
[zk: localhost:2181(CONNECTED) 4] ls /dubbo 
[com.dubbo3.service.DubboService, com.study.service.DubboService, config, mapping, metadata, org.apache.dubbo.metadata.MetadataService, org.apache.dubbo.mock.api.MockService]
[zk: localhost:2181(CONNECTED) 5] ls /dubbo/com.dubbo3.service.DubboService 
[configurators, consumers, providers, routers]
[zk: localhost:2181(CONNECTED) 6] ls /dubbo/com.dubbo3.service.DubboService/providers 
[dubbo%3A%2F%2F192.168.10.3%3A20999%2Fcom.dubbo3.service.DubboService%3Faccesslog%3Dtrue%26anyhost%3Dtrue%26application%3Dprovider%26deprecated%3Dfalse%26dubbo%3D2.0.2%26dynamic%3Dtrue%26generic%3Dfalse%26interface%3Dcom.dubbo3.service.DubboService%26metadata-type%3Dremote%26methods%3DsayHello%26pid%3D5745%26release%3D3.0.1%26revision%3D1.0.0%26side%3Dprovider%26timestamp%3D1660570641796%26version%3D1.0.0]
[zk: localhost:2181(CONNECTED) 7] ls /
[dubbo, services, zookeeper]
[zk: localhost:2181(CONNECTED) 8] ls /services 
[dubbo-admin, provider]
[zk: localhost:2181(CONNECTED) 9] ls /services/provider 
[192.168.10.3:20999]
[zk: localhost:2181(CONNECTED) 10] ls /services/provider/192.168.10.3:20999
[]
[zk: localhost:2181(CONNECTED) 11] get /services/provider/192.168.10.3:20999
{"name":"provider","id":"192.168.10.3:20999","address":"192.168.10.3","port":20999,"sslPort":null,"payload":{"@class":"org.apache.dubbo.registry.zookeeper.ZookeeperInstance","id":null,"name":"provider","metadata":{"accesslog":"true","anyhost":"true","application":"provider","deprecated":"false","dubbo":"2.0.2","dubbo.endpoints":"[{\"port\":20999,\"protocol\":\"dubbo\"}]","dubbo.metadata-service.url-params":"{\"version\":\"1.0.0\",\"dubbo\":\"2.0.2\",\"release\":\"3.0.1\",\"port\":\"20999\",\"protocol\":\"dubbo\"}","dubbo.metadata.revision":"fb5a5fb554c76bdcd9241d5ce3e71477","dubbo.metadata.storage-type":"local","dynamic":"true","generic":"false","interface":"com.dubbo3.service.DubboService","metadata-type":"remote","methods":"sayHello","pid":"5745","release":"3.0.1","revision":"1.0.0","side":"provider","timestamp":"1660570641796","version":"1.0.0"}},"registrationTimeUTC":1660570643750,"serviceType":"DYNAMIC","uriSpec":null}

已有 1 条评论

  • Jackie Wang2022-08-15
    Dubbo 3 深度剖析 - 透过源码认识你课程资源: 链接: https://pan.baidu.com/s/14o5Ue4u3w97JkeHSfl6UwQ 提取码: r8k4 解压密码就是 www.dmzshequ.com
感谢参与互动!
  • OωO
  • |´・ω・)ノ
  • ヾ(≧∇≦*)ゝ
  • (☆ω☆)
  • (╯‵□′)╯︵┴─┴
  •  ̄﹃ ̄
  • (/ω\)
  • ∠( ᐛ 」∠)_
  • (๑•̀ㅁ•́ฅ)
  • →_→
  • ୧(๑•̀⌄•́๑)૭
  • ٩(ˊᗜˋ*)و
  • (ノ°ο°)ノ
  • (´இ皿இ`)
  • ⌇●﹏●⌇
  • (ฅ´ω`ฅ)
  • (╯°A°)╯︵○○○
  • φ( ̄∇ ̄o)
  • ヾ(´・ ・`。)ノ"
  • ( ง ᵒ̌皿ᵒ̌)ง⁼³₌₃
  • (ó﹏ò。)
  • Σ(っ °Д °;)っ
  • ( ,,´・ω・)ノ"(´っω・`。)
  • ╮(╯▽╰)╭
  • o(*////▽////*)q
  • >﹏<
  • ( ๑´•ω•) "(ㆆᴗㆆ)
  • (。•ˇ‸ˇ•。)
  • 颜文字